Avoid Getting for SureWin Lies: A Guide to Staying Safe

The internet is packed with gimmicks promising quick and easy riches. These "guaranteed win" offers prey on your desire for financial success, but they're ultimately designed to cheat you out of your hard-earned cash. Don't let yourself become a victim! Learn to spot these red flags and safeguard yourself from falling for their deceitful strategies.

  • Doubt any offer that seems too good to be true.
  • Investigate carefully before investing in anything online.
  • Find reviews and testimonials from verified sources.
  • Refrain from sharing personal information with unfamiliar websites or individuals.
  • Flag any suspicious activity to the appropriate authorities.
